Transaction 1ddd3aa671756f6156206e2636a4ee8eda2bfce9fd824ce82c442dc21bb0fa93
1 Input
1 Output
-
1ddd3aa671756f6156206e2636a4ee8eda2bfce9fd824ce82c442dc21bb0fa93:0
- value
- 432662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9e66adf1d3011ff5f428531aa438102c8fdb3d1 OP_EQUAL
- address
- 3P1mPvh3dy8VSAcvkNLzLTpSLU2TLGmrEq